Description

  • Ferrite drum core construction.
  • Magnetically unshielded.
  • L
  • Product weight:0.5g(Ref.)
  • Moisture Sensitivity Level: 1
  • RoHS compliance.
  • Halogen Free available. Environmental Data
  • Operating temperature range: -30 ℃~ +100 ℃ (including coil’s self temperature rise)
  • Storage temperature range: -30 ℃~ +100 ℃
  • Solder reflow temperature: 260 ℃ peak. Packaging
  • Carrier tape and reel packaging.
  • 12.9”diameter reel
  • 1000pcs per reel

Applications
